New TGP traffic trade
 
Hello there! I created my first TGP website -sexblix.com and I signed up for trade traffic in over 40 TGP sites. The problem is that I don't get any traffic, I have added the URL's to my trade script and it works fine, I suspect they didn't approved my site yet because they don't get any clicks from me since I don't have any traffic or is it something else? What do you do when you start a new TGP, how do you get your first visitors?

Dude a TGP has almost nothing for a search engine to crawl. I?ll probably get some heat for this and I?m not trying to step on anyone?s toes but SEO is pointless. Paying for traffic if you don?t know what you are doing is a waste of time and money. They never serve up enough hits in a short period of time to due anything. You?re going to have to drive traffic to your TGP the old fashion way, through the use of backlinks. I am going to say it again. TGPs are not dead. TGPs are great source of backlink traffic. Traffic is what we all want. So to dismiss this, like some will due is to overlook one factor in getting the maximum amount of possible traffic to a site. The quickest way to get backlinks to your site is the old fashion way by building galleries and submitting them to a few choice fee TGP?s. This is not sexy and it not fun. You signed up for too many trades for one thing. You're never going to be able to feed all of those trades from nothing. You should start out with a couple of trades, build up a steady trading relationship, then add a couple more etc etc.
